
额,这个是最简单的了:
你先连接数据库,然后用
sql语句
查询数据库里用户表是否存在此用户:
string
str="select
from
用户表
where
用户名='"+Textbox1text+"'
and
密码='"+Textbox2text+"'";
dataset
dt=new
dataset();
SqlDataAdapter
sda=new
SqlDataAdapter(str,con);//con是你连接数据库的字符串;
sdaFill(dt);
if(dtTables[0]Rowscount>0)
{
这里表示存在,进行你的
跳转代码
;
}
else
{
messagebox
show("用户不存在或者用户名和密码错误!");
}
vc里面可以定义bit的数据类型么?
VC里不能定义bit数据类型,但是可以定义bool类型,bool类型占用4字节内存空间
要引用哪个头文件?
不需要引用
c语言存储的最小单元不是byte么?
一般来说是byte,但是像51这类单片机具有位寻址功能,所以允许使用bit类型
c里面定义的话是不是先要定义一个byte常量,然后再在这个byte上面进行位 *** 作吧,也不能直接定义bit类型吧
keil
c51里面可以直接定义bit类型,但是像vc这些pc上的应用程序不允许,bit类型是keil
c51里面对标准c的一个扩展,在其他编译器上是无法编译的
FALSE:
1、条件为假
2、值为0
3、返回值为FALSE
TRUE:
1、条件为真
2、值为1
3、返回值为TRUE
扩展资料:
FALSE 和TRUE是布尔值。
在逻辑中,真值或逻辑值是指示一个陈述在什么程度上是真的。在计算机编程上多称作布尔值。
在经典逻辑中,唯一可能的真值是真和假。但在其他逻辑中其他真值也是可能的: 模糊逻辑和其他形式的多值逻辑使用比简单的真和假更多的真值。
在代数上说,集合 {真,假} 形成了简单的布尔代数。可以把其他布尔代数用作多值逻辑中的真值集合,但直觉逻辑把布尔代数推广为 Heyting代数。
在 topos理论中,topos 的子对象分类器接管了真值集合的位置。
取出数据,循环一次就可以了
<php
foreach($row as $v){
><input
<php
if($v == true)
echo "checked";}
>
/>
如果是true 就在input输出 checked 那么按钮就是被选择状态了
有两三年没碰,具体代码实在是写不出来,不好意思 楼上说的ajax方法也可以,那个就比较倾向js脚本,前端工程师方面,我这个就是倾向php工程师方面的,两种都是web行业的基础,但是岗位不同,建议你都练习一下,不管会不会,只要有了思路,直接动手做,遇到什么问题就解决问题就是了,这样做的快,学的也快,感觉也很好
标识可以当主键,但是主键不一定是标识。标识可以创建表的时候一同创建了,比如在字段前面添加一个id 当做标识,然后这个id设置自增长。
如:create table tablename(id int auto_increment not null,sname varchar(10));
这个属性设成 ON 是非常危险的,AUTO_CLOSE 设置为 ON 时,该选项可能导致频繁访问数据库而使性能下降,这是因为在每次连接后打开和关闭数据库增加了开销。AUTO_CLOSE 还会在每次连接后刷新过程缓存。
有N种方法,一种是数据库端控制的。有时候数据不反悔true或false,返回的是1或0
select case sex when true then '男' when 1 then '男' when false then '女' when 0 then '女'
另一种是服务器端的
后台写个方法
public string GetSex(object o){
if(oToString() == "0" || oToString() == "true")
return "男";
else if(oToString() == "1" || oToString() == "false")
return "女";
}
然后前台绑定
<%# GetSex(Eval("six)) %>
以上就是关于c#输入数据查询数据库中是否存在此数据并返回true or false全部的内容,包括:c#输入数据查询数据库中是否存在此数据并返回true or false、数据库中性别定义的数据类型为bit ,为什么不让用true和false、函数公式中的FALSE 和TRUE分别指的是什么等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)